黑狐家游戏

负载均衡 高可用 区别,负载均衡与高可用,深入解析两者的区别与应用场景

欧气 0 0
负载均衡与高可用虽相关但有所区别。负载均衡主要指将请求分散到多个服务器,提高资源利用率;而高可用则关注系统持续运行的能力。应用场景上,负载均衡适用于资源分散、性能优化需求;高可用则针对系统稳定性和可靠性要求高的场景。两者结合使用,可实现高效、稳定的系统架构。

本文目录导读:

  1. 负载均衡
  2. 高可用
  3. 负载均衡与高可用的区别
  4. 应用场景

在当今信息化时代,随着互联网的飞速发展,负载均衡和高可用成为了保障系统稳定运行的重要手段,负载均衡和高可用虽然都与系统性能和稳定性息息相关,但它们在实现方式、应用场景等方面存在显著差异,本文将从这两个概念的定义、区别以及应用场景等方面进行深入解析。

负载均衡

负载均衡(Load Balancing)是一种将多个请求分发到多个服务器上的技术,目的是为了提高系统的处理能力和稳定性,在负载均衡过程中,请求会被分配到性能最佳的服务器上,从而实现资源的合理利用和系统的平稳运行。

1、负载均衡的分类

(1)基于IP的负载均衡:通过修改目标IP地址,将请求分发到不同的服务器上。

负载均衡 高可用 区别,负载均衡与高可用,深入解析两者的区别与应用场景

图片来源于网络,如有侵权联系删除

(2)基于端口的负载均衡:通过修改目标端口号,将请求分发到不同的服务器上。

(3)基于应用层的负载均衡:通过分析应用层协议,将请求分发到不同的服务器上。

2、负载均衡的优势

(1)提高系统处理能力:通过将请求分配到多个服务器,提高系统的并发处理能力。

(2)提高系统稳定性:在某个服务器出现故障时,负载均衡可以将请求分配到其他正常服务器,确保系统正常运行。

(3)降低单点故障风险:通过将请求分发到多个服务器,降低单点故障对系统的影响。

高可用

高可用(High Availability)是指系统在长时间运行过程中,能够持续满足用户需求,且故障恢复时间尽可能短,高可用主要关注系统在面临故障时的应对能力,通过冗余设计、故障转移等技术手段,确保系统在故障发生时仍能正常运行。

1、高可用的实现方式

(1)硬件冗余:通过使用多台硬件设备,确保在某个设备出现故障时,其他设备可以接管其工作。

(2)软件冗余:通过冗余的软件模块,确保在某个模块出现故障时,其他模块可以接管其工作。

负载均衡 高可用 区别,负载均衡与高可用,深入解析两者的区别与应用场景

图片来源于网络,如有侵权联系删除

(3)故障转移:在某个节点出现故障时,将请求转移到其他正常节点。

2、高可用的优势

(1)提高系统稳定性:在故障发生时,高可用技术可以确保系统持续提供服务。

(2)降低故障恢复时间:通过冗余设计和故障转移,缩短故障恢复时间。

(3)提高用户满意度:系统在面临故障时,仍能持续提供服务,提高用户满意度。

负载均衡与高可用的区别

1、目标不同

负载均衡的目标是提高系统处理能力和稳定性,而高可用的目标是降低故障风险,确保系统在故障发生时仍能正常运行。

2、实现方式不同

负载均衡主要关注请求的分配,而高可用主要关注系统的冗余设计和故障转移。

3、应用场景不同

负载均衡 高可用 区别,负载均衡与高可用,深入解析两者的区别与应用场景

图片来源于网络,如有侵权联系删除

负载均衡适用于需要提高处理能力和稳定性的场景,如电商平台、在线教育等;高可用适用于需要降低故障风险、提高系统稳定性的场景,如金融系统、政府网站等。

应用场景

1、负载均衡的应用场景

(1)电商平台:提高购物网站的处理能力和稳定性,应对高峰期的访问量。

(2)在线教育平台:确保课程直播、在线考试等服务的稳定运行。

2、高可用的应用场景

(1)金融系统:降低交易风险,确保交易系统的稳定性。

(2)政府网站:提高政府服务的可用性,满足公众需求。

负载均衡和高可用是保障系统稳定运行的重要手段,在实际应用中,应根据系统需求选择合适的技术方案,实现系统的高性能、高可用。

标签: #负载均衡策略 #高可用性设计 #应用场景分析

黑狐家游戏
  • 评论列表

留言评论